金色財經訊,3月12日消息,以太坊核心開發者Mikhail Kalinin在以太坊2.0技術規范中發表了關于將以太坊1.0合并至2.0的討論稿(WIP),他表示和DannyRyan在最近的一次以太坊2.0會議中討論了該話題,雙方正在制定技術規范,以實現“最小化合并”的方案。
“最小化合并”方案很早已經提出,該方案指出的Eth1.0和Eth2.0的合并發生在Eth1.X的過渡時期。
該方案的基礎思路是構建“可執行信標鏈”,也就是將信標鏈和Eth1.0做出一個耦合狀態,也是將Eth1.0數據作為信標鏈的“數據分片”之一提供可用數據,其中便涉及到對Eth1.0客戶端的修改設計。
以下為該方案的簡述,刪除了部分晦澀難懂的代碼和技術詞語:
以太坊以rollup為中心的路線圖宣布將數據分片作為eth2中主要執行的擴容思路,從而允許在單個執行分片上實現可伸縮性并簡化總體設計。這是一個eth2執行模型,可替代可執行分片,并支持信標鏈中包含的單個執行線程。
分析 | 金色盤面:比特幣Google Trends指數上升:金色盤面綜合分析:據Google Trends數據顯示,bitcoin一詞在全球搜索熱度有所回升,主要搜索地區來自非洲國家,其中proshares bitcoin etf一詞近7日搜索量最高。[2018/8/24]
Eth1分片設計假設通過信標鏈與數據分片進行通信。如果將推出具有多個執行分片的第2階段,則此方法很有意義。由于主要關注以rollup為中心的路線圖,因此將Eth1放在專用分片上(即獨立于信標鏈并經常“交聯”信標鏈)給共識層增加了不必要的復雜性,并增加了在分片上發布數據和訪問分片之間的延遲。
因此該方案建議通過將eth1數據(事務,狀態根等)嵌入信標塊并讓信標提議者有義務生成可執行的eth1數據來擺脫這種復雜性。這體現了作為共識核心的eth1執行力和有效性。
金色相對論 | 相里朋:幣改鏈改都需要為實體經濟賦能:本期金色相對論中,在關于“ 鏈改,為什么?改什么?”這一問題上,工信部電子五所高級工程師相里朋表示:“不管是幣改鏈改還是區塊鏈+,本質都是為實體經濟賦能,如果做不到這點。那就是空中樓閣。做區塊鏈行業有個通病,絕大多數企業提幣改鏈改,鮮有真正從客戶需求,真實痛點出發。對方業務是什么樣都不清楚,就敢提出一大堆邏輯來。客戶原有業務有哪些流程,上下游如何,有哪些可以用技術解決,優化調整,痛點在哪里,如何解決。這些都是關鍵問題,每一個細分行業都不一樣,不是簡單上個鏈,發個幣就能解決的。”
相里朋還表示:“我認為鏈改對社會意義遠大于經濟效益。當然經濟溢出也很重要。我在推進的兩個事,一個是將個人 企業現實實體映射到虛擬實體,用于構建新型誠信體系。另一個是溯源提升制造企業產品質量,促進制造業高質量發展。幣改,現階段還太早,金錢永遠都是把雙刃劍,不靠譜的是我們自己的人性。在沒辦法控制前,小范圍探索是可以嘗試的,大規模實踐,只會讓行業更加混亂。就像現在幣圈跑路潮,亂象才剛剛開始。”[2018/8/10]
因此做出了以下的提案:
分析 | 金色盤面:ETH短線再次下跌:金色盤面綜合分析:ETH短線再次下跌,15分鐘出現MACD背離現象,關注幣價波動,短線或出現小幅反彈。[2018/8/8]
Eth1引擎由系統中的驗證器維護,當驗證者打算提出一個信標塊時,它要求eth1-engine創建eth1數據。然后,將Eth1數據嵌入正在生成的信標塊的主體中。如果eth1數據無效,它也會使攜帶該數據的信標塊無效。
Eth1引擎的修改
根據之前的內容,以Eth1 Shard為中心,設計eth1-engine和eth2-client松散耦合并通過RPC協議進行通信(檢查eth1 + eth2客戶端關系)。Eth1引擎不斷維護需要自己的網絡堆棧的事務池和狀態下載器。它還應保留eth1塊的存儲。
金色財經現場報道 V神在會場闡述二次分片的由來 :金色財經6月3日現場報道,在今天的以太坊技術及應用大會上,以太坊創始人Vitalik Buterin做了題為“Casper與分片技術最新進展”的主題演講。假設一個節點能處理N個交易,那么主鏈能追蹤N個分片,每個分片都能處理N個交易,所以系統一共能處理N的2次方個交易,因此這個提案叫二次分片。[2018/6/3]
當前的提議刪除了eht1塊的概念,而eth1-engine有兩種可能的方式來處理此更改:
從信標塊攜帶的eth1數據中綜合創建eth1塊
修改引擎,使交易處理不需要eth1塊,而是使用eth1數據
前一種選擇看起來比后一種選擇更短期。它允許將eth1客戶端更快地轉換為eth1-engine,并且已經通過eth1 shard PoC進行了證明。
調整后,需要使用可執行數據術語來表示包括eth1狀態根,交易列表(包括收據根和bloom過濾器),coinbase,時間戳,塊散列以及eth1狀態轉換功能所需的所有其他數據位的數據。
此外,eth1引擎責任的清單與我們以前對Eth1 Shard的責任相似。主要觀察eth1引擎的下列行為:
交易執行。
事務池維護。
可執行數據創建。
狀態管理。
JSON-RPC支持。
信標塊處理
將ExecutableData結構替換Eth1Data進入信標塊主體。此外,信標鏈和eth1的同步處理可實現即時存款。因此,可以從信標塊體去除沉積物。
在EVM中訪問信標塊狀態
我們更改BLOCKHASH了用于返回eth1塊哈希的操作碼的語義。而是返回信標塊根。這允許檢查從256信箱之前的時隙到上一個信箱包括的信標狀態或塊中包含的那些數據的證明。異步狀態讀取有一個主要缺點。客戶端必須等待一個塊,才能創建帶有鏈接到該塊的證明或它產生的狀態根的交易。簡而言之,異步狀態訪問至少要延遲一個時隙。
直接狀態訪問
假設eth1引擎可以訪問表示整個信標狀態的merkle樹。然后,EVM可能帶有操作碼,可READBEACONSTATEDATA(gindex)提供對任何信標狀態的直接訪問。該操作碼具有幾個不錯的屬性。首先,這種讀取的復雜性取決于gindex價值,并且易于計算,因此可以輕松推斷出天然氣價格。其次,返回數據的大小為32字節,完全適合EVM的32字節字。
使用此操作碼,可以創建更高級別的信標狀態訪問器庫,從而為智能合約提供便捷的API。
該模型消除了狀態訪問延遲。因此,通過對信標鏈操作和eth1執行適當的排序(后者遵循前者),N-1可以在插槽中訪問到插槽分片數據的交叉鏈接N,從而允許匯總以最快的方式證明數據的包含。而且,這種方法降低了信標狀態讀取的數據和計算復雜性。
直接訪問的成本增加了eth1引擎的復雜性。讀取信標狀態的能力可以通過不同的方式實現:
傳遞狀態以及可執行數據。這種方法的主要問題是處理大尺寸的狀態副本。如果將直接訪問限制為狀態數據的一個子集,而該狀態數據的子集需要將一小部分狀態傳遞給執行,那么它可能會起作用。
雙工通信通道。擁有雙工通道,eth1-engine將能夠同步向信標節點詢問EVM請求的狀態。根據通道的設置方式,延遲可能會成為執行具有信標狀態讀取的事務的瓶頸。
嵌入式eth1引擎。如果將eth1-engine嵌入信標節點(例如,作為共享庫),則它可以通過節點提供的主機功能從相同的存儲空間讀取狀態。
Tags:ETHGIN以太坊ENGETHVAULTOperon Origins以太坊價格今日行情美元實時ChallengeDAC
香港時間周四02:00,美國聯邦公開市場委員會(FOMC)將公布利率決議。另外,香港時間周四02:30,美聯儲主席鮑威爾將召開新聞發布會.
1900/1/1 0:00:00本文主要探討了數字時代民族國家的數字分裂以及隨后個人主權的擴大,并深入地分析全球向主權過渡背后的一個關鍵催化創新:比特幣.
1900/1/1 0:00:003月10日,開源軟件資助平臺?Gitcoin?啟動了為期15天第9輪捐贈活動。不少知名DeFi項目便從Gitcoin孵化出來,上面也匯聚了很多知名開發者和有創意的想法,普通用戶參與捐贈還有機會獲.
1900/1/1 0:00:00美國的加密貨幣用戶即將迎來納稅季節,即使他們計劃將資產保持數字化,非同質化代幣(NFT)的買家也可能無法免于納稅.
1900/1/1 0:00:00熱點摘要: 1.?美聯儲將基準利率維持在0%-0.25%不變。2.?灰度推出BAT、LINK、MANA、FIL及LPT信托產品,FIL突破90美金.
1900/1/1 0:00:00比特幣市場概述 隨著傳統金融巨頭摩根士丹利和Visa宣布進一步采用比特幣,比特幣市場繼續在5.36萬美元和6.15萬美元之間盤整.
1900/1/1 0:00:00